| 1 | /* lineup.c | ||
| 2 | |||
| 3 | Converts a file to uppercase in-place. | ||
| 4 | |||
| 5 | Incidentally, another way to do this while avoiding the seeks | ||
| 6 | would be to open the input file, then remove() it and reopen | ||
| 7 | it under another handle. Because of Unix deletion semantics | ||
| 8 | this works fine. */ | ||
